// Notes for the weekly eng sync re: Gallerywhisper, our museum audio-guide app.
// This constant sets the prefetch radius for exhibit audio clips. At the
// Hollen Pavilion pilot we learned visitors walk faster than our original
// estimate, so clips were buffering mid-stride. Bumping this to three rooms
// ahead fixed it, at a modest bandwidth cost. Don't lower it without testing
// on the slow gallery wifi first — seriously, it's painful. The trace token
// from the pilot build that validated this number is appended just below.

trace token, kahap-bagaf: htk4_8458

## v2.8.0 — Changed defaults

The Inkhopper spooler microservice no longer assumes a single upstream printer pool. Default retry behavior changed from infinite retries to a capped backoff, since the old behavior wedged queues whenever a printer in the Dorvale office went offline overnight. Job TTL is now enforced at the spooler rather than by the client, and stale jobs are purged automatically. If you're maintaining this later: these changes are intentional, don't revert them. The new shipped defaults are as follows.

config for kafof-bawef:
holath:
  log_level: debug
  metrics_host: metrics.holath.qorvelsys.internal
  pin: 2191
  pool_size: 32

**Alert: Nightly Search Reindex Overrun — Pindlewick Search**

This alert fires when the nightly reindex of the Pindlewick catalog exceeds its four-hour window, which risks delaying the morning release gate. Verify the indexer completed before approving any deploy touching search schemas; a partial index can silently drop results. If the run is still incomplete at 06:00, notify the reindex duty owner directly.

alerts address for kajog-tadup: druox@plorvanet.internal

Subject: Quickstore 4.2 — bloom filter now fronts the KV layer

Plugin authors: starting with this release, Quickstore places a bloom filter ahead of the key-value store. Negative lookups return faster; false positives fall through safely. No API changes are required on your side. Verify your plugin against the staging build referenced below.

session token of fahif-tadup = htk3_9c7